1. Size and Capacity

When it comes to selecting a fondue pot, size and capacity are important factors to consider. The size of the pot will determine how much fondue you can make at once, while the capacity will determine how many people you can serve.

For smaller gatherings or intimate dinners, a small fondue pot with a capacity of 1 to 2 quarts may suffice. On the other hand, if you frequently entertain larger groups, a larger pot with a capacity of 3 to 4 quarts or more would be a better choice.

Keep in mind that the size of the pot should also be proportional to the size of your dining table or countertop where you plan to use it. You don’t want a pot that overwhelms the space or makes it difficult for guests to reach.

2. Material and Construction

The material and construction of the fondue pot play a crucial role in its overall performance and durability. The most common materials used for fondue pots are stainless steel, ceramic, and cast iron.

Stainless steel fondue pots are popular due to their durability, heat conductivity, and ease of cleaning. They are also resistant to rust and corrosion, making them a great long-term investment.

Ceramic fondue pots, on the other hand, are known for their aesthetic appeal and ability to retain heat. They come in a variety of colors and designs, allowing you to match them with your kitchen decor. However, they may be more fragile compared to stainless steel pots and require extra care when handling.

Cast iron fondue pots are known for their excellent heat retention and even heat distribution. They are perfect for cooking fondues that require consistent heat, such as chocolate or cheese fondues. However, they can be heavy and may require more effort to clean and maintain.

3. Heating Method

The heating method of a fondue pot determines how the pot is heated and maintained at the desired temperature. There are two common heating methods: fuel-based and electric.

Fuel-based fondue pots use a burner fueled by either liquid fuel or gel fuel to heat the pot. They offer a traditional and authentic fondue experience, but they require careful handling and monitoring of the flame. Electric fondue pots, on the other hand, use an electric heating element to heat the pot. They are convenient and easy to use, as they allow you to set and maintain the desired temperature with precision.

Ultimately, the choice between fuel-based and electric fondue pots depends on your personal preference and the level of convenience you desire.

1. What is a fondue pot and how does it work?

A fondue pot is a versatile cooking vessel that is specifically designed for melting and keeping various types of foods warm, typically for dipping. It consists of a pot, a heating element, and often comes with forks for dipping. The pot is placed on the heating element, which can be fueled by electricity, candles, or fuel gels. The heat source keeps the contents of the pot at a desired temperature, allowing you to enjoy a delicious and interactive dining experience.

2. What types of fondue pots are available?

There are several types of fondue pots available, each with its own unique features and benefits. Some common types include:

– Electric Fondue Pots: These are the most popular and convenient option. They provide consistent heat and are easy to use, making them ideal for both beginners and experienced fondue enthusiasts.

– Ceramic Fondue Pots: These pots are aesthetically pleasing and great for retaining heat. They are available in various designs and colors, adding a touch of elegance to your dining table.

– Stainless Steel Fondue Pots: These pots are durable and easy to clean. They are a popular choice for those who prefer a more modern and sleek look.

3. What should I consider when buying a fondue pot?

When buying a fondue pot, there are a few important factors to consider:

– Size: Consider the number of people you’ll be serving and choose a pot that can accommodate the desired quantity of food.

– Heat Source: Decide whether you prefer an electric, candle, or fuel gel-powered fondue pot based on your needs and preferences.

– Material: Choose a pot made from a durable and heat-resistant material such as stainless steel or ceramic.

4. Can I use a fondue pot for other types of cooking?

Yes, you can use a fondue pot for various types of cooking, not just for fondue. It can be used for melting cheese or chocolate, keeping sauces warm, or even for cooking meat, seafood, and vegetables in oil or broth. The versatility of a fondue pot allows you to experiment with different recipes and create a unique dining experience for your guests.

5. How do I properly clean a fondue pot?

Properly cleaning a fondue pot is essential to maintain its longevity and ensure food safety. Most fondue pots are dishwasher safe, but it is recommended to hand wash them to prevent any damage. Use warm, soapy water and a non-abrasive sponge to clean the pot thoroughly. Rinse it well and dry it completely before storing. Be cautious when cleaning the heating element, and always follow the manufacturer’s instructions for cleaning and maintenance.
